A rollator is an ambulator that has three or four wheels. It also has seats, as well as a storage bag. They are more maneuverable than traditional walkers, with four wheels, and are generally lighter in weight. They are also more compact and fold easily for transport and storage. Depending on the model, they can support up 250 pounds. Some are designed to accommodate bariatric patients and have a wider seat.

There are a variety of models of rolling walkers on the market. They can be used by anyone of any age. Some are designed for indoor use only, while others can be used on sidewalks, grass and gravel. The size of the tires, wheel size and turning radius are different for every type of walker.

Most rolling walkers have an armchair and a basket to store items. Some even have a brake lever, which lets you control the speed and direction of your journey. Some are specifically designed for users who don't need seats and are a more streamlined design that is ideal for doorways and tight spaces.

There are many kinds of brakes for rollators. Loop-lock brakes are tough plastic hand loops placed beneath the handlebars. They may get tiresome for some users with limited hand strength. Bicycle brakes work exactly the same way as the loop-lock brakes but using levers. A brake that is pushed down is an alternative option that can be easier to use for users with reduced hand strength.
